#3d0e02 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#3d0e02 is composed of 23.9% red, 5.5% green and 0.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 77% magenta, 96.7% yellow and 76.1% black. It has a hue angle of 12.2 degrees, a saturation of 93.7% and a lightness of 12.4%. #3d0e02 color hex could be obtained by blending #7a1c04 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330000.

Shades and Tints of #3d0e02
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040100 is the darkest color, while #fff3f0 is the lightest one.
